Data table header descriptions
ID_REF
ID_REF
CH1I_MEAN
Mean feature pixel intensity at wavelength 532 nm.; Type: integer; Scale: linear_scale
CH2I_MEAN
Mean feature pixel intensity at wavelength 635 nm.; Type: integer; Scale: linear_scale
CH1B_MEDIAN
The median feature background intensity at wavelength 532 nm.; Type: integer; Scale: linear_scale; Channel: Cy3 Channel; Background
CH2B_MEDIAN
The median feature background intensity at wavelength 635 nm.; Type: integer; Scale: linear_scale; Channel: Cy5 channel; Background
CH1D_MEAN
The mean feature pixel intensity at wavelength 532 nm with the median background subtracted.; Type: integer; Scale: linear_scale; Channel: Cy3 Channel
CH2D_MEAN
.The mean feature pixel intensity at wavelength 635 nm with the median background subtracted.; Type: integer; Scale: linear_scale; Channel: Cy5 channel
CH1I_MEDIAN
Median feature pixel intensity at wavelength 532 nm.; Type: integer; Scale: linear_scale
CH2I_MEDIAN
Median feature pixel intensity at wavelength 635 nm.; Type: integer; Scale: linear_scale
CH1B_MEAN
The mean feature background intensity at wavelength 532 nm.; Type: integer; Scale: linear_scale; Background
CH2B_MEAN
The mean feature background intensity at wavelength 635 nm.; Type: integer; Scale: linear_scale; Background
CH1D_MEDIAN
The median feature pixel intensity at wavelength 532 nm with the median background subtracted.; Type: integer; Scale: linear_scale
CH2D_MEDIAN
The median feature pixel intensity at wavelength 635 nm with the median background subtracted.; Type: integer; Scale: linear_scale
CH1_PER_SAT
The percentage of feature pixels at wavelength 532 nm that are saturated.; Type: integer; Scale: linear_scale
CH2_PER_SAT
The percentage of feature pixels at wavelength 635 nm that are saturated.; Type: integer; Scale: linear_scale
CH1I_SD
The standard deviation of the feature intensity at wavelength 532 nm.; Type: integer; Scale: linear_scale; Channel: Cy3 Channel
CH2I_SD
The standard deviation of the feature pixel intensity at wavelength 635 nm.; Type: integer; Scale: linear_scale; Channel: Cy5 channel
CH1B_SD
The standard deviation of the feature background intensity at wavelength 532 nm.; Type: float; Scale: linear_scale; Channel: Cy3 Channel; Background
CH2B_SD
The standard deviation of the feature background intensity at wavelength 635 nm.; Type: integer; Scale: linear_scale; Channel: Cy5 channel; Background
PERGTBCH1I_1SD
The percentage of feature pixels with intensities more than one standard deviation above the background pixel intensity, at wavelength 532 nm.; Type: integer; Scale: linear_scale
PERGTBCH2I_1SD
The percentage of feature pixels with intensities more than one standard deviation above the background pixel intensity, at wavelength 635 nm.; Type: integer; Scale: linear_scale
PERGTBCH1I_2SD
The percentage of feature pixels with intensities more than two standard deviations above the background pixel intensity, at wavelength 532 nm.; Type: integer; Scale: linear_scale
PERGTBCH2I_2SD
The percentage of feature pixels with intensities more than two standard deviations above the background pixel intensity, at wavelength 532 nm.; Type: integer; Scale: linear_scale
SUM_MEAN
The sum of the arithmetic mean intensities for each wavelength, with the median background subtracted.; Type: integer; Scale: linear_scale
SUM_MEDIAN
The sum of the median intensities for each wavelength, with the median background subtracted.; Type: integer; Scale: linear_scale
RAT1_MEAN
Ratio of the arithmetic mean intensities of each spot for each wavelength, with the median background subtracted. Channel 1/Channel 2 ratio, (CH1I_MEAN - CH1B_MEDIAN)/(CH2I_MEAN - CH2B_MEDIAN) or Green/Red ratio.; Type: float; Scale: linear_scale
RAT2_MEAN
The ratio of the arithmetic mean intensities of each feature for each wavelength, with the median background subtracted.; Type: float; Scale: linear_scale
RAT2_MEDIAN
The ratio of the median intensities of each feature for each wavelength, with the median background subtracted.; Type: float; Scale: linear_scale
PIX_RAT2_MEAN
The geometric mean of the pixel-by-pixel ratios of pixel intensities, with the median background subtracted.; Type: float; Scale: linear_scale
PIX_RAT2_MEDIAN
The median of pixel-by-pixel ratios of pixel intensities, with the median background subtracted.; Type: float; Scale: linear_scale
RAT2_SD
The geometric standard deviation of the pixel intensity ratios.; Type: float; Scale: linear_scale
TOT_SPIX
The total number of feature pixels.; Type: integer; Scale: linear_scale
TOT_BPIX
The total number of background pixels.; Type: integer; Scale: linear_scale
REGR
The regression ratio of every pixel in a 2-feature-diameter circle around the center of the feature.; Type: float; Scale: linear_scale
CORR
The correlation between channel1 (Cy3) & Channel 2 (Cy5) pixels within the spot, and is a useful quality control parameter. Generally, high LOG_RAT2N_MEDIANs imply better fit & good spot quality.; Type: float; Scale: linear_scale
DIAMETER
The diameter in um of the feature-indicator.; Type: integer; Scale: linear_scale
X_COORD
X-coordinate of the center of the spot-indicator associated with the spot, where (0,0) is the top left of the image.; Type: integer; Scale: linear_scale
Y_COORD
Y-coordinate of the center of the spot-indicator associated with the spot, where (0,0) is the top left of the image.; Type: integer; Scale: linear_scale
TOP
Box top: int(((centerX - radius) - Xoffset) / pixelSize).; Type: integer; Scale: linear_scale
BOT
Box bottom: int(((centerX + radius) - Xoffset) / pixelSize).; Type: integer; Scale: linear_scale
LEFT
Box left: int(((centerY - radius) - yoffset) / pixelSize).; Type: integer; Scale: linear_scale
RIGHT
Box right: int(((centerY + radius) - yoffset) / pixelSize); Type: integer; Scale: linear_scale
FLAG
The type of flag associated with a feature: -100 = user-flagged null spot; -50 = software-flagged null spot; 0 = spot valid.; Type: integer; Scale: linear_scale
